public string Excluir(TRegistro_LanCCustoLancto val) { Hashtable hs = new Hashtable(1); hs.Add("@P_ID_CCUSTO", val.Id_ccustolan); return(executarProc("EXCLUI_FIN_CCUSTOLANCTO", hs)); }
public string Gravar(TRegistro_LanCCustoLancto val) { Hashtable hs = new Hashtable(8); hs.Add("@P_ID_CCUSTO", val.Id_ccustolan); hs.Add("@P_CD_CENTRORESULT", val.Cd_centroresult); hs.Add("@P_NR_ORCAMENTO", val.Nr_orcamento); hs.Add("@P_VL_LANCTO", val.Vl_lancto); hs.Add("@P_DT_LANCTO", val.Dt_lancto); hs.Add("@P_CD_EMPRESA", val.Cd_empresa); hs.Add("@P_TP_REGISTRO", val.Tp_registro); hs.Add("@P_DS_OBSERVACAO", val.Ds_observacao); return(executarProc("IA_FIN_CCUSTOLANCTO", hs)); }
public TList_LanCCustoLancto Select(TpBusca[] vBusca, Int32 vTop, string vNM_Campo) { TList_LanCCustoLancto lista = new TList_LanCCustoLancto(); SqlDataReader reader = null; bool podeFecharBco = false; if (Banco_Dados == null) { podeFecharBco = CriarBanco_Dados(false); } try { reader = ExecutarBusca(SqlCodeBusca(vBusca, Convert.ToInt16(vTop), vNM_Campo)); while (reader.Read()) { TRegistro_LanCCustoLancto reg = new TRegistro_LanCCustoLancto(); if (!(reader.IsDBNull(reader.GetOrdinal("Id_CCustoLan")))) { reg.Id_ccustolan = reader.GetDecimal(reader.GetOrdinal("Id_CCustoLan")); } if (!(reader.IsDBNull(reader.GetOrdinal("CD_CentroResult")))) { reg.Cd_centroresult = reader.GetString(reader.GetOrdinal("CD_CentroResult")); } if (!(reader.IsDBNull(reader.GetOrdinal("DS_CentroResultado")))) { reg.Ds_centroresultado = reader.GetString(reader.GetOrdinal("DS_CentroResultado")); } if (!reader.IsDBNull(reader.GetOrdinal("nr_orcamento"))) { reg.Nr_orcamento = reader.GetDecimal(reader.GetOrdinal("nr_orcamento")); } if (!reader.IsDBNull(reader.GetOrdinal("st_deducao"))) { reg.st_deducao = reader.GetString(reader.GetOrdinal("st_deducao")); } if (!(reader.IsDBNull(reader.GetOrdinal("VL_Lancto")))) { reg.Vl_lancto = reader.GetDecimal(reader.GetOrdinal("VL_Lancto")); } if (!reader.IsDBNull(reader.GetOrdinal("CD_Empresa"))) { reg.Cd_empresa = reader.GetString(reader.GetOrdinal("CD_Empresa")); } if (!reader.IsDBNull(reader.GetOrdinal("NM_Empresa"))) { reg.Nm_empresa = reader.GetString(reader.GetOrdinal("NM_Empresa")); } if (!reader.IsDBNull(reader.GetOrdinal("tp_movimento"))) { reg.Tp_movimento = reader.GetString(reader.GetOrdinal("tp_movimento")); } if (!reader.IsDBNull(reader.GetOrdinal("dt_lancto"))) { reg.Dt_lancto = reader.GetDateTime(reader.GetOrdinal("dt_lancto")); } if (!reader.IsDBNull(reader.GetOrdinal("nr_lancto"))) { reg.Nr_lancto = reader.GetDecimal(reader.GetOrdinal("nr_lancto")); } if (!reader.IsDBNull(reader.GetOrdinal("nr_docto"))) { reg.Nr_docto = reader.GetString(reader.GetOrdinal("nr_docto")); } if (!reader.IsDBNull(reader.GetOrdinal("cd_clifor"))) { reg.Cd_clifor = reader.GetString(reader.GetOrdinal("cd_clifor")); } if (!reader.IsDBNull(reader.GetOrdinal("nm_clifor"))) { reg.Nm_clifor = reader.GetString(reader.GetOrdinal("nm_clifor")); } if (!reader.IsDBNull(reader.GetOrdinal("cd_contager"))) { reg.Cd_contager = reader.GetString(reader.GetOrdinal("cd_contager")); } if (!reader.IsDBNull(reader.GetOrdinal("cd_lanctocaixa"))) { reg.Cd_lanctocaixa = reader.GetDecimal(reader.GetOrdinal("cd_lanctocaixa")); } if (!reader.IsDBNull(reader.GetOrdinal("id_cupom"))) { reg.Id_cupom = reader.GetDecimal(reader.GetOrdinal("id_cupom")); } if (!reader.IsDBNull(reader.GetOrdinal("id_emprestimo"))) { reg.Id_emprestimo = reader.GetDecimal(reader.GetOrdinal("id_emprestimo")); } if (!reader.IsDBNull(reader.GetOrdinal("id_adto"))) { reg.Id_adto = reader.GetDecimal(reader.GetOrdinal("id_adto")); } if (!reader.IsDBNull(reader.GetOrdinal("tp_registro"))) { reg.Tp_registro = reader.GetString(reader.GetOrdinal("tp_registro")); } if (!reader.IsDBNull(reader.GetOrdinal("PathCentroresult"))) { reg.PathCentroresult = reader.GetString(reader.GetOrdinal("PathCentroresult")); } if (!reader.IsDBNull(reader.GetOrdinal("ds_observacao"))) { reg.Ds_observacao = reader.GetString(reader.GetOrdinal("ds_observacao")); } lista.Add(reg); } } finally { reader.Close(); reader.Dispose(); if (podeFecharBco) { deletarBanco_Dados(); } } return(lista); }